CHAMPIONSHIP FORMAT

The scoring format for the PGA of BC Seniors' Championship is a 36-hole stroke play competition. Players are expected to return scorecards to the PGA of BC scoring table immediately after completion of play. Scorecards must have the signature of the player and scorer before players are permitted to leave the scoring area.

DISTANCE MEASURING DEVICES

In this competition, a player may obtain distance information by use of a distance-measuring device. If, during a stipulated round, a player uses a distance-measuring device to gauge or measure other conditions that might affect his/her play (e.g. elevation changes, wind speed, etc.) the player is in breach of Rule 14-3. First breach of Rule 14-3 is a two stroke penalty, any subsequent breach is disqualification.
